Travel Channel Documentaries

Travel Channel Documentaries

Street Foods International (2012x7)


:

Hawker stands and food carts are a common sight in Asia and throughout Europe. On land and waterways, these street-food vendors serve hot or cold food items traditional to their region.

  • :
  • : 164
  • : 1
  • Travel Channel